Linux下数据库高效部署与稳定运维实战
|
在Linux环境下部署数据库,需优先选择适合业务场景的开源方案。MySQL与PostgreSQL是主流选择,前者以高性能和广泛支持著称,后者则在复杂查询与数据完整性方面表现更优。安装前应确认系统已更新至最新状态,并配置好防火墙规则与依赖库,避免后续因环境问题导致服务异常。 数据库安装完成后,关键在于配置优化。通过修改my.cnf(MySQL)或postgresql.conf(PostgreSQL)文件,合理调整缓冲区大小、连接数上限与日志策略,可显著提升并发处理能力。例如,将innodb_buffer_pool_size设置为物理内存的70%左右,能有效减少磁盘读写开销,提升响应速度。
2026AI模拟图,仅供参考 数据安全不容忽视。启用SSL加密通信,限制root账户远程登录,使用独立用户运行数据库进程,均能降低潜在风险。定期备份是运维核心环节,建议结合rsync或pg_dump实现增量与全量备份,并将备份文件存放在异地或云存储中,确保灾难恢复能力。监控系统是保障稳定运行的重要支撑。利用Prometheus配合Grafana搭建可视化监控平台,可实时追踪CPU、内存、连接数及慢查询等关键指标。设置合理的告警阈值,一旦发现异常立即通知运维人员,做到故障早发现、快响应。 日常维护中,定期清理无用日志文件、分析慢查询日志并优化相关SQL语句,有助于保持数据库高效运转。同时,关注数据库版本更新,及时应用补丁修复已知漏洞,避免因软件缺陷引发服务中断。通过标准化脚本管理启动、停止与重启流程,可减少人为操作失误。 综上,高效的数据库部署与稳定运维依赖于科学规划、精细配置与持续监控。掌握这些实战技巧,不仅能提升系统性能,还能大幅降低运维风险,为业务系统提供坚实可靠的数据支撑。 (编辑:站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

